Chen Yue felt that Mo Dong was drunk.

Normally, Mo Dong would be like a clam clinging to its hard lime shell, he would never say such words easily.

He said he was a failure and incompetent.Can't do anything well.want to escape.

Those self-deprecating words made Chen Yue breathless.

He bent down and raised Mo Dong's head slightly.

The usually indifferent and world-weary eyes are now red like a wronged rabbit, the whites of the eyes are bloodshot, the lower eyelashes are wet, and wisps of misty watery light swirls in the eye sockets.

Chen Yue's heart was severely scratched, he hastily knelt down beside the bed, "Mo Dong is the best in Chen Yue's heart."

He shook his pale hand sadly, "How many times do I have to tell you before you will believe that you are my baby."

He took a tissue and carefully wiped his overflowing tears, "Don't cry, please, please."

Mo Dong didn't seem to hear what he said, he turned his face away, and a hoarse voice came from under the quilt, "It's too late, it's too late."

Chen Yue went around the bed to the left, squatted down, and asked him patiently, "Why is it too late?"

"Duration...management software...too little time."

Chen Yue understood, what Mo Dong was talking about was the management system of the pet hospital.

"Fool," he gently brushed away Mo Dong's drooping forehead hair, "It's just such a small matter, it's so urgent. It's okay, take your time."

He squeezed his neck, "Does it still hurt now, here."

Mo Dong was dull for a while, and then said, "It doesn't hurt anymore."

Chen Yue helped him move his body slowly, took off his coat, pulled the quilt over and covered his neck.

Mo Dong opened his eyes and looked at him, looking a little dazed.

He touched Mo Dong's sweaty forehead and wiped it dry with a tissue, "Go to sleep, I'll leave later."

Mo Dong closed his eyes, opened them again after a while, his eyes seemed to be searching for something everywhere.

"what happened?"

"...Bai...Weiyi, puppy." Mo Dong said softly.

Chen Yue was stunned for a moment, then laughed, got up and went to the living room to get the clothes on the sofa,

Mo Dong stared at it with fixed eyes, reached out to take it clumsily, stuffed it into the quilt, and then closed his eyes with peace of mind.

Chen Yue fixed the quilt for him and was about to leave when he suddenly noticed a book dropped on the ground and it was spread out.He picked it up, and it was a fairy tale book with many colored illustrations, orange kangaroos, big and small, fluffy.

Chen Yue put the book on the bedside table, and gently closed the door for him. When he turned his head, Du Guo stood behind him.

"Aren't you going to stay overnight?" He scratched his blue hair like a chicken coop suspiciously.

Chen Yue smiled.

Du Guo didn't quite understand the meaning of his smile, so he asked tentatively, "Are you reconciled?"

Chen Yue didn't know how to answer him, so he reached out and patted his shoulder, "It's late, I'm leaving first."

"Oh." Du Guo watched him tidy up the wine and cups on the coffee table in the living room, and shook his head, "Remember to close the door."

Chen Yue walked out of the apartment gate, and was blown by the gentle evening wind, the heat from his body faded a lot.He stood by the road, looked up, and saw that the light from the small white window on the fifth floor hadn't turned on again, so he felt relieved and drove home.

Early the next morning, he drove the car and squatted under Mo Dong's building, and sent Mo Dong a message: The temperature is a bit low today, so wear thicker clothes.

Then he dialed Jiang Yanzhou's phone number.

"Hey, buddy, the hospital will open next Friday. Do you know how much the loss will be if the new system goes online one day later?" Jiang Yanzhou thought he heard it wrong when Chen Yue said that the software company's construction period was delayed. .

"I will bear the loss." Chen Yue said.

"You have too much money to burn, right?" Jiang Yanzhou took a deep breath, suppressing the urge to scold others, "If the efficiency of this company is not good, let's find another one."

"It's too late to change, and the quality can't be guaranteed in such a short period of time." Chen Yue analyzed to him on the other end.

"All right, all right, I don't care, you can figure it out yourself."

Just as Chen Yue hung up the phone, he saw Mo Dong coming out of the glass revolving door of the apartment. He got off the car and waved his arms to greet him, "Mo Dong, here!"

Mo Dong paused briefly, then walked towards him hesitantly.

"Have you had breakfast?" Chen Yue turned to look at him.

Mo Dong lowered his head and fastened his seat belt, and said, "Go and buy near the company."

Chen Yue started the car, turned on the music, the folk guitar plucked softly, and the soothing melody flooded into the car like a tide, and the trees on both sides of the street retreated one by one.

"Did you sleep well last night?" Chen Yue asked.

Mo Dong held the seat belt with his hands, and his fingertips subconsciously picked the patterns on it.

He was drunk last night, but that doesn't mean he didn't remember anything. On the contrary, he remembered everything Chen Yue said clearly.

"Ah."

"Have a headache?" Chen Yue continued to ask without letting him go.

"It doesn't hurt."

"Do you remember what I told you last night?"

Mo Dong's breathing stopped suddenly, and he replied stiffly, "I don't remember."

Chen Yue smiled, "It's okay."

After sending Mo Dong downstairs to the company, he said, "Are you still working overtime tonight? I'll pick you up."

Mo Dong should have refused, but he didn't know whether what Chen Yue said to him last night was effective or because of other reasons, he hesitated for a while, but finally he acquiesced.

After a good night's sleep, his mind became clearer. After he changed yesterday's code into a debugging environment, all the red crosses disappeared magically.

Halfway through the work, Xiao Zhang notified everyone in the group that ddl was delayed for one week.He glanced at it for a while, then shut the phone into the drawer.

Chen Yue would pick him up downstairs on time every day and often bring him some gadgets.

A pile of colorful pebbles. "For your little turtle to bask in the sun."

A pair of flat mirrors. "Anti-blue light can protect eyesight."

A white cat mouthwash cup. "You should like it."

There are other little bits and pieces.It was not something expensive, and Mo Dong was too embarrassed to refuse.

Gradually, when he got off work every day, he couldn't help but wonder what Chen Yue brought him today.

A week later, Mo Dong finally finished all the codes, handed over the program to his colleagues, and got off work two hours earlier than before.

Chen Yue waited for him downstairs as usual.

"Why is it so early today?"

"My part of the job is done."

"Congratulations." Chen Yue looked at him with a smile, "I can pick you up earlier in the future. By the way,"

Mo Dong turned his head to him, "What?"

Chen Yue turned around and took out a little fluffy doll from the back seat.

"cute?"

It was a 25cm female kangaroo with light brown hair all over, and a baby kangaroo was stuffed in the pouch, with ears the size of fingernails propped up softly, and big round eyes looking curiously.

Mo Dong glanced at it, then quickly turned his head to the window, the skin near his ears turned slightly red, "You peeked at my book."

Chen Yue didn't expect to be questioned by him instead, so he was a little nervous, "No, I... your book fell on the floor, I picked it up for you, I saw it by accident."

Mo Dong didn't speak.

Chen Yue said cautiously, "I was wrong, I will never read your book again next time."

He tentatively put the kangaroo doll into Mo Dong's hands, "Don't be angry."

Mo Dong wasn't angry at all, he just felt extremely embarrassed.A soft little doll was stuffed in the hand, and the fingertips touched the soft touch, and the heartstrings seemed to be plucked.

He lowered his head and touched mother kangaroo's fat pouch, "I'm not angry, thank you."

Only then did Chen Yue feel relieved, put his hands on the steering wheel again, "Just as long as you like it."

After driving for a while, Chen Yue suddenly remembered something, "Mo Dong, it's almost the end of the year, when are you going on vacation?"

"On New Year's Eve."

"Are there any arrangements? Are you...do you celebrate the New Year alone?" Chen Yue asked, he didn't know if Mo Dong still had contact with his family.

Mo Dong was silent for a while, then lowered his head and fiddled with the doll in his hand before saying, "Yes."

"I just want to go to Northern Europe for a while, do you want to go?" He took the time to glance at Mo Dong, and continued a little nervously, "If you don't want to go, forget it."

"Feel sorry."

"I'm sorry, it's okay, I just asked casually." Chen Yue was indeed a little disappointed, but he still smiled, "I will take a picture of you after going there, if you think it looks good, you can go to play by yourself next time .”

He sent Mo Dong downstairs.

Mo Dong held the doll in his hand and stood in front of the apartment gate.

Chen Yue lowered the car window, "Remember to eat on time. I'm leaving first. If you need something, call me. My mobile phone is on 24 hours a day."

Mo Dong nodded, then watched the car disappear from sight.

Winter is coming, the wind is a bit cold, blowing the yellow leaves falling from the ground, rustling.

Du Guo also just arrived home, and was in the kitchen to drink water, when he heard a voice, he poked his head out, "Brother Xiaodong, you won't be working overtime today? Hey, what are you holding in your hand?"

Mo Dong subconsciously carried the doll back, "It's nothing."

Du Guo thought he was weird, as if he was hiding something shady, he shrugged, and after drinking a few sips of water, he suddenly remembered something, "Brother Xiaodong, I'm going back to my hometown next week, do you want to go back to my hometown again?" stay here?"

This apartment was rented by Du Guo and Mo Dong three years ago. Du Guo's home is out of town, and he will not go back until the Spring Festival.

But Du Guo has never seen Mo Dong go home, and he has never seen him mention his family, let alone call his family.

He always suspected that Mo Dong was an orphan.

"Brother Xiaodong, if you don't have time, you can invite a few friends to come and play. Use my room as you like, otherwise it will be deserted here alone."

Mo Dong nodded to him, "Thank you."

He closed the door, sat down on the edge of the bed, put the mother kangaroo on his lap, grabbed the baby kangaroo by the head and pulled it out of the pouch.

Besides Chen Yue, what friends do I have?

Mo Dong stretched his fingers into the pouch, feeling the fluffiness and softness brought by the polyester fiber filled in the inner core.

One should get used to the desertedness of a person.

He turned his head to look at the little kangaroo that had been thrown away next to him. His big round eyes were staring at the ceiling woodenly. The light next to him gathered a small bright spot on its eyeball, like a drop of tear.
